What Size Dumpster Should I Get for a Residential Clean Out in Maricopa?
Residential clean outs typically don't demand large dumpsters. The size that you just need, however, will be contingent on the size of the undertaking.
Should you plan to clean out the whole home, then you most likely need a 20-yard roll off dumpster. You can likewise use this size for a big cellar or loft clean out.
Should you just need to clean out a room or two, then you might want to select a 10-yard dumpster.
When picking a dumpster, though, it is frequently wise to ask for a size larger than what you believe you will need. Unless you are a professional, it is difficult to gauge the precise size needed for your project. By getting a somewhat larger size, you spend a little more money, but you also prevent the possibility that you will run out of room. Renting a larger dumpster is almost always cheaper than renting two small ones.
Security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ster
Follow these recommendations to stay safe while by means of a rental dumpster.
1. Participate the rear w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a little incline could induce it to roll.
2. Do not overfill the dumpster. Items shouldn't stick out of the top opening.
3. Use caution when opening the dumpster door, and be sure you lock it when you're finished.
4. Wear safety gloves to protect your hands while loading debris.
5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y things to the dumpster.
6. Just let adults close to the dumpster.
7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. As soon as they enter the landfill, they can leak out and contaminate your local ground water.
8. Be sure you have lots of light when transferring debris to the dumpster. Should you plan to work at twilight, get a light that provides enough illumination.

Deciding Where to Put Your Dumpster
Deciding where to put your dumpster can have a huge impact regarding how quickly you complete endeavors. The most efficient option would be to pick a location that is near the worksite. It's important, nevertheless, to consider whether this location is a safe alternative. Make sure the place is free of obstructions that could trip folks while they take heavy debris.
Many folks choose to set dumpsters in their driveways. This is a convenient alternative since it generally means you can avoid asking the city for a license or permit. If you have to set the dumpster on the street, then you should get in touch with your local government to ask whether you need to get a permit. Although a lot of municipalities will let people keep dumpsters on the road for brief amounts of time, others are going to request that you fill out some paperwork. Following these rules can help you stay away from fines which will make your job more costly.
Long-Term vs Rolloff dumpsters
Whether or not you need a permanent or roll-off dumpster depends upon the type of job and service you'll need. Long-Term dumpster service is for ongoing demands that last longer than just a couple of days. This includes matters like day-to-day waste and recycling needs. Temporary service is just what the name implies; a one-time demand for job-special waste removal.
Temporary roll off dumpsters are delivered on a truck and are rolled off where they will be used. These are generally larger containers that could manage all the waste that comes with that particular job. Long-Term dumpsters are usually smaller containers because they're emptied on a regular basis and so do not need to hold as much at one time.
Should you request a long-term dumpster, some companies demand at least a one-year service agreement for this dumpster. Rolloff dumpsters just require a rental fee for the time that you just keep the dumpster on the job.

Dumpster rental guidelines
When you need to rent a dumpster in Maricopa to use at your house, it's a great idea to keep several guidelines in mind. First, ascertain the size dumpster that'll work best for your job. Temporary dumpsters commonly come in 10, 20, 30 and 40 yard sizes. Then think about the positioning of the dumpster on your own premises. Recommendations call for you to give a place that is double the width and height of the container. This may ensure appropriate height and space clearance.
The price you're quoted for the container will have a one-time delivery and pickup fee, together with regular fees for disposal, fuel and tax. You must also realize you could simply fill the container to the top; no debris should be sticking out. As the homeowner, it's also wise to check to your local city or municipality to find out whether a license is necessary to put the container on the street.

Paying for your dumpster
If you would like to rent a dumpster in Maricopa, you'll find that prices vary substantially from state to state and city to city. One means to get genuine estimates for the service you need is to phone a local dumpster business and ask regarding their prices. You may also request a quote online on some sites. These sites may also contain full online service that is always open. On these sites, you can select, schedule and pay for your service whenever it is convenient for you.
Variables which affect the price of the container contain landfill fees (higher in some places than others) and also the size of the container you choose. You also need to consider transportation costs and also the type of debris you'll be setting into your container.
Price quotes for concrete dumpster in Maricopa generally contain the following: the size of the container, the type of debris involved, the base price for the dumpster, how much weight is contained in the quote, a specified rental period and delivery and pick-up fees.

Dumpster Sizes Available Maricopa
Get started in less than 60 seconds. Pick up the phone and get a quote now!
10 Yard
Great for small projects
- 12 feet long
- 8 feet wide
- 4 feet tall
Popular
20 Yard
For moderate sized cleanouts
- 22 feet long
- 8 feet wide
- 4.5 feet tall
30 Yard
All around good dumpster size
- 22 foot long
- 8 feet wide
- 6 feet tall
40 Yard
For the largest projects
- 22 foot long
- 8 feet wide
- 8 feet tall
*Dimensions & availability may vary by location. Call to confirm.
